... Garnet is the birthstone for the month of January ... Garnet got its name from the Latin word for pomegranite, granatum, because of its red color ... Garnet comes in a rainbow of colors including purple, pink, orange, brown, and green, but the most common color is red. ... Garnet is said to symbolize the fire of love. Its other meanings include fidelity, truth, and strength. It is said to protect travelers, prevent fevers, improve one's health, and promote cheerfulness and sincerity. At times, it was recommended to cure heart palpitations and diseases of the blood. ... the discovery of garnet often means that diamonds are nearby.
